WINNIPEG — Following are a few highlights in the Canadian and world feed grains markets on Wednesday, Nov. 4.

• CBOT corn futures were three cents per bushel lower in early activity on Wednesday. Part of the pressure was caused by private forecasters raising their estimates for U.S. production.

• Delivered elevator prices for feed barley across the Prairies ranges from $3.36 to $4.70 per bushel, according to Prairie Ag Hotwire.

• Delivered elevator feed wheat prices are between $4.81 and $6.26 in locations across the Prairies, according to Prairie Ag Hotwire.
